Output 39e908d63e54a5eb79d239d2034f34e4cc16761e92fb61d6ff55aa03b2541914:4

value
311165
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 995e68b0a5e0ae2f48a89e08277b8e6cfb4d00a6 OP_EQUALVERIFY OP_CHECKSIG
address
1EywUzvECW6251FCVRQjCW8HSo4W8ttd4K
transaction
39e908d63e54a5eb79d239d2034f34e4cc16761e92fb61d6ff55aa03b2541914
spent
true